Introduction

DB Cargo UK is currently recruiting for a Facilities Manager to join our Property department supporting the South region.

As a Facilities Manager, you will work with in-house teams and external contractors to ensure efficient facilities management across operational and tenanted properties. A key aspect of the role is supporting the implementation of our Facilities Management Strategy to optimise costs and improve service delivery.

Across your region you will be responsible for budget management, ensuring cost-effective solutions while maintaining high standards of service. Additionally, you will oversee asset management, ensuring the upkeep, maintenance, and lifecycle planning of company assets. You will monitor and manage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and Service Level Agreements (SLAs) to drive performance and ensure service excellence.

This is a regional role with hybrid working opportunity and the expectation to be on site 3-4 days per week.

What will you be doing?

You will lead the delivery of facilities management across your region, covering approximately 30 properties. You'll oversee estate improvement projects, ensuring they are delivered efficiently and safely within live operational environments.

Working closely with contract partners, you will coordinate the delivery of a full range of facilities management services. A key part of the role involves effective budget management—tracking expenditure, identifying cost-saving opportunities, and ensuring services are delivered in a cost-efficient and high-quality manner.

You will also maintain strict compliance with health and safety regulations, fostering a safe working environment while making strategic decisions that drive operational excellence and long-term value.

What are we looking for?

We are looking for an experienced professional who is able to demonstrate expertise in property asset management, maintenance planning and stakeholder management skills.

You’ll need to bring experience in budget management experience, with a focus on cost control and financial planning.

A trade qualification is a requirement for this role for example plumbing, gas, electrical or fabric.

Due to the role’s responsibilities, we are looking for someone who holds a full driving license and ability to travel as required.

NEBOSH or IOSH Managing Safety qualification is desired.
